Elizabeth Bowen. Death of the heart (№ 415669)

Sadness certainly knocks the soil out from under a person's feet. Almost immediately, it turns out that the refined art of silence is only suitable for happy days - or for those days when the pain is at least bearable. But as soon as sadness gains full power, this feeling becomes painful, poisonous, any pride perishes under its onslaught.
